Indian students should go for the University of Hamburg admissions because it does not charge a tuition fee. Only a semester fee of around EUR 315 (INR 34.2K) is applicable and this fee covers a six-month Hamburg public transport pass. (EUR 1 = INR 108.82)
- Scholarships: If you do not want to pay anything, including the semester fee and the cost of living at the University of Hamburg, then apply for Hamburg scholarships like DAAD (awarding EUR 992 monthly) or the Deutschlandstipendium, awarding EUR 300 monthly. Apply in October/November annually

To get into this university, Indian students need a mandatory APS certificate, provide academic transcripts (equivalent to German entrance requirements), German language proficiency at C1 level for most UG courses and English or German language proficiency for PG courses.

The one thing Indian students have a hard time understanding is the APS Certificate requirement for Hamburg admissions, not the academics. It is the document verification process via the German missions in India, and it takes time, a lot of it. Students applying for it the same month as the TUHH application deadlines are too late. I always advise students to start the University of Hamburg application at least 8 months before the July or January deadlines at this university. Now, Indain students also need to plan for a dMAT test to get their APS.

Can I Work in Germany After Graduation from TUHH?
Yes, Indian students get an 18-month Job Seeker Permit to look for full-time jobs in Germany. There are no restrictions on your employment, meaning you can work for any employer and in any role. When you find a job relevant to the Hamburg University of Technology degree, the transition from Job seeker visa to Work visa or an EU Blue Card is possible.
To get the EU Blue Card via fast track, the applicants need to meet the given requirements -
- Highly skilled role
- Meeting the salary threshold
- Pass at least a B1 level of German (Without B1 German, it takes 27 months)

Major Update on APS: Indian students applying for PG programs in Engineering, Commerce, Accounting, Finance, Business and Economics are required to take the dMAT (Digital Master Assessment Test) to get an APS from the Summer 2027 intake.
